2017 screw. Bone stock with 21,000. Purchased used. Just noticed front end sits 3/4” higher in the front. Had mechanic check front and rear shocks. Stock with no damage. Checked rear leaf springs. Rear leaf springs appear to sag in front of the axle, rose back up to go over axle and continue to arch to rear connection. The second leaf actually appears to be separated from the top one with a gap/bend. Has anyone had experience with faulty leafs? Covered under warranty?

Is the block still in the back? Some people remove and slightly raise the front for the Brorunner/Cali-Lean look. I'd check for the rear block and then check the front for a perch collar or even worse, a spacer lift/strut extension. Take some pics if you can

I used to regularly bend leaf springs on my crawler before I linked it. Sound like maybe it was used in some high traction spots or abused by power braking, alot, who knows. I would bet you could find a set of good used take offs cheap, if you don't want to spring for deavers or whatever.

If it's stock, the factory 2" block isn't doing you any favors. Though, I have 38k on mine and springs are fine.

Take a few pictures of the leaf separation and where the U-bolts go around the axle to see if it has the blocks removed. Whatever it is, it is not normal. Unless it was abused by the previous owner, it should be covered under your warranty.
